Pronoun
- 1 Zir; the gender-neutral object of a verb or preposition that also appears as the subject. gender-neutral, nonstandard, personal, pronoun, reflexive, singular, third-person
"I'm trying to point out that his 'help' would be seriously damaging to a person who lacks the ability to fix zirself through a sheer act of will."
- 2 Ze; an intensive repetition of the gender-neutral subject, often used to indicate the exclusiveness of that person as the only satisfier of the predicate. emphatic, gender-neutral, nonstandard, personal, pronoun, singular, third-person

Etymology
From zir + -self.
